Research Notes: Ravens have never been used for sending messages. The depiction of ravens/crows as messengers is a mythological one. Messenger birds are pigeons and some doves because they have great homing abilities. Several theories have been introduced for how they manage to get home, from being able to detect the magnetic field, to being able to identify landmarks, but we really don't know.
In a similar vein, the birds weren't able to fly out to different locations with letters. They’re smart, but still just birds. Someone would take a caged bird to different location, and when a message needed to be sent, it would fly back home with a letter. That's why they're called homing pigeons.
Pigeons within Thedas would likely be housed in a dovecote or pigeon tower. Some were actual towers, and some were carved into a caves. Dovecotes nowadays often look like large birdhouses with many holes for different pairs.
"Culverhouse" is a surname that means "a person who tends to or lives near a dovecote," so that's just the title I'm going with.
